Marc Sallés Esteve (born 6 May 1987, Terrassa) is a Spanish field hockey midfielder. At the 2012 Summer Olympics, he competed for the national team in the men's tournament.

Personal life

As of 2012, Salles studies Business Administration Salles is 141 pounds (64 kilograms) in weight, 170 centimetres (5 feet 7 inches) tall and is right-handed.

Field hockey

Salles is coached by national coach Daniel Martin. He currently plays for Atletic de Terrassa, in Terrassa, Catalonia. Marc Sallés winning goal against France in August 2011 at the GANT EuroHockey Championship secured A division status for Spain in 2013.

Salles participated in six matches in London during the preliminary round of Pool A. At the 2012 Summer Olympics in London, he competed in the field hockey men's tournament but did not score.
